龙芯2K1000实战开发-以太网/串口设计
目录
概要
整体架构流程
技术名词解释
1.收发器:
2.PHY:
3.变压器:
4.串口:
5.RGMII
技术细节
1.主要芯片选型与使用
2.以太网变压器选用:
小结
概要
本文主要针对2k1000的以太网及串口的国产化设计
整体架构流程
提示:这里可以添加技术整体架构
整体架构,以太网,使用2k1000自带的以太网mac控制器,外选用国产化PHY,国产化变压器。
整体框架,如下图,主要是器件选型

串口,以RS232为例子,选用国产化RS232收发器。
技术名词解释
提示:这里可以添加技术名词解释
1.收发器:
简单来说,发射器和接收器的组合,主要用于连接网络内的电子设备,并允许它们传输和接收消息。 在局域网中,网络接口卡包括一个收发器,该收发器在线路上传输信号并通知信号。本文主要是串口,个人认为主要是逻辑电平与物理电平之间的转换。
2.PHY:
PHY 是物理接口收发器,它实现物理层。包括 MII/GMII (介质独立接口) 子层、PCS (物理编码子层) 、PMA (物理介质附加) 子层、PMD (物理介质相关) 子层、MDI 子层。定义了数据传送与接收所需要的电与光信号、线路状态、时钟基准、数据编码和电路等,并向数据链路层设备提供标准接口。物理层的芯片称之为PHY。
3.变压器:
网络变压器(Ethernet Transformer,也称数据汞/网络隔离变压器)模块是网卡电路中不可或缺的部分,它主要包含中间抽头电容、变压器、自耦变压器、共模电感。该变压器一般都安装在网卡的输入端附近。工作时,由收发器送出的上行数据信号从络变压器的Pin16-Pin15进入,由Pin10-Pin11输出,经RJ45型转接头,再通过非屏蔽双绞线送往服务器;服务器送来的下行数据信号经另一对非屏蔽双绞线和RJ45型转接头,由Pin7-Pin6进入,由Pin1-Pin2输出,然后送到网卡的收发器上。
4.串口:
串行接口简称串口,也称串行通信接口或串行通讯接口(通常指COM接口),是采用串行通信方式的扩展接口。串行接口 (Serial Interface)是指数据一位一位地顺序传送。其特点是通信线路简单,只要一对传输线就可以实现双向通信(可以直接利用电话线作为传输线),从而大大降低了成本,特别适用于远距离通信,但传送速度较慢。
5.RGMII
RGMII(Reduced Gigabit Media Independent Interface)是Reduced GMII(吉比特介质独立接口)。RGMII均采用4位数据接口,工作时钟125MHz,并且在上升沿和下降沿同时传输数据,因此传输速率可达1000Mbps。同时兼容MII所规定的10/100 Mbps工作方式,支持传输速率:10M/100M/1000Mb/s ,其对应clk 信号分别为:2.5MHz/25MHz/125MHz。RGMII数据结构符合IEEE以太网标准,接口定义见IEEE 802.3-2000。采用RGMII的目的是降低电路成本,使实现这种接口的器件的引脚数从25个减少到14个。
技术细节
1.主要芯片选型与使用
以太网芯片选用:LS2K1000 的 GAMC 符合 RGMII2.0 协议规范。RGMII2.0 协议 不支持在控制器端添加时钟延时功能,在使用时建议连接有时钟内部 延时功能的 PHY。这一点很关键,这里我们选用裕太车通的YT8521;


值得注意德是,这里我们选用有源晶振替代无源晶振时,需要注意,与一般芯片不同德是,这里需要接在负极(输出引脚XTLO)
使用phy内部电源时,内核电源走线需要按手册要求进行设计,核心要点短而粗
2.以太网变压器选用:
选用汉仁德HR682480;
变压器配置德时候,需要注意的是,我们这里德PHY是电压型phy,不需要上拉电阻,直接下拉到地就可以。这个关于电压和电路phy的区别配置。我有写专门的文章说明,这里可以参考嵌入式之以太网。
串口收发器选用:雷卯科技德SIT202eese;

小结
本文主要对2K1000的外设,以太网和串口进行设计,并对于一些设计要点和案例进行了分享。
本文来自互联网用户投稿,文章观点仅代表作者本人,不代表本站立场,不承担相关法律责任。如若转载,请注明出处。 如若内容造成侵权/违法违规/事实不符,请点击【内容举报】进行投诉反馈!
